Earthquake Details: 8 km ESE of Molalla, Oregon
Sep 1, 2026, 19:47:22
A magnitude 2.1 earthquake occurred near 8 km ESE of Molalla, Oregon on Sep 1, 2026 at 19:47:22. The seismic event was recorded at a depth of -0.77 km. No tsunami warning was issued.
